Description
Fly ash brick (FAB) is a building material.Fly ash bricks are lighter and stronger than clay bricks. Main ingredients include fly ash, water, quicklime or lime sludge, cement, aluminum powder and gypsum. Autoclaving increases the hardness of the block by promoting quick curing of the cement.
The raw materials for Fly Ash Bricks are:
Material | Mass |
---|---|
Fly Ash | 60% |
Sand/Stone Dust | 30 % |
Ordinary Portland Cement/(Lime+Gypsum) | 10% |
Total formula of material | 100% |
The strength of fly ash brick manufactured with the above compositions is ranges between 7.5 MPa and 10 MPa.
Advantages
- It reduces dead load on structures due to light weight (2.6 kg, dimension: 230 mm X 110 mm X 70 mm.
- Same number of bricks will cover more area than clay bricks
- High fire Insulation
- Due to high strength, practically no breakage during Transport and use.
- Due to uniform size of bricks mortar required for joints and plaster reduces almost by 50%.
- Due to lower water penetration Seepage of water through bricks is considerably reduced.
- Gypsum plaster can be directly applied on these bricks without a backing coat of Lime plaster.
- These bricks do not require Soaking in water for 24 hours. Sprinkling of water before use is enough.
